-Too many mechanic visits, Lets start with Baleno
-the car has suspension noises from day one, after 1 month Suzuki margalla motors agreed to fix it making noise on the right side.
-Electrical issues are a zillion
-Suspension arms fail very easily and need to be changes completly
-Spares of this car are extremly expensive (taking about genuine stuff) since you mentioned breaks Corollas OEM Toyota packing break pads cost 2400-2800 Balenos cost 4500
The spark plug coil in a Corolla that uses 4 costs around 2500-3500, Balenos cost 900 for wire and 7k for Coil (2 coils and 2 wires = 16000 for the pair (mostly the set needs changing altogether changed thrice in the ownership of 5 years) Corolla / Vitz driven above 190,000 orignal sets good to go
Suzuki Pakistan stoped supporting parts for Baleno, Atleast they did not in 2008, had to source centre (Gatri) from sheirshah.
Suspension arms cost 18k for a pair had to change one every year, Yes our cars driven on very very rough terrain, Corolla/Vitz are being driven on the same terrain, Not a single issue alhamdulillah.
Water body died, Engine gasket killed the engine head had to replace that just because of a burnt fuse that didnt make the fan work. Baleno has an almunium head (probably the most expencive in any car in Balenos range).
